﻿.dani-results .mud-progress-linear {
    height: 25px !important;
}

.mud-progress-linear.bar-pass-gold .mud-progress-linear-bars .mud-progress-linear-bar {
    background: linear-gradient( 90deg, rgb(255,83,147) 0%, rgb(255,248,6) 15%, rgb(255,248,6) 20%, rgb(122,255,79) 30%, rgb(122,244,255) 45%, rgb(149,104,255) 70%, rgb(255,98,244) 90%, rgb(255,98,244) 95%, rgb(255,83,147) 100% );
}

.mud-progress-linear.bar-pass-red .mud-progress-linear-bars .mud-progress-linear-bar {
    background-color: #ff584d;
}

.mud-progress-linear.bar-default .mud-progress-linear-bars .mud-progress-linear-bar {
    background-color: lightgrey;
}

.mud-progress-linear.bar-pass-gold .mud-typography,
.mud-progress-linear.bar-pass-red .mud-typography {
    font-weight: bold;
    color: #333;
}

.color-box {
    width: 16px;
    height: 16px;
    border-radius: 9999px;
    display: inline-block;
    margin-right: 10px;
    border: 1px solid black;
    position: relative;
    top: 2px;
}

.columns-panel {
    column-count: 2;
}

.ai-battle-td {
    position: sticky;
    left: 0;
    top: 0;
    z-index: 99;
    background: #FAFAFA;
    display: none;
}

.dialog-user-qr-code svg {
    /* makes the qr code render with no subpixels */
    transform: scale(1.1);
}

@media only screen and (min-width: 600px) {
    .ai-battle-td {
        display: revert;
    }
}